Podrobná bibliografia
| Názov: |
Захист від DDOS-атак на мовах програмування JAVA та C# ; Cyber protection in programming languages JAVA and C# |
| Autori: |
Андрощук, А. В. |
| Rok vydania: |
2023 |
| Zbierka: |
erKNUTD - Electronic Repository Kyiv National University of Technologies and Design |
| Predmety: |
кіберзахист, мова програмування Java, мова програмування C#, атаки, вразливості, атаки на мережу, захист від атак, практики програмування, шифрування даних, cyber protection, Java programming language, C# programming language, attacks, vulnerabilities, attacks on the network, protection against attacks, programming practices, data encryption |
| Popis: |
Мета роботи – проаналізувати і порівняти можливості кіберзахисту у Java та C# та визначити переваги та недоліки кожної мови з точки зору безпеки програмного забезпечення. В основу розробки системи ефективних засобів кіберзахисту було покладено основні механізми кіберзахисту, доступні у мовах програмування Java та C#, такі як виключення, контроль доступу, шифрування даних та перевірка вводу. В ході дослідження було проведено аналіз загроз та вразливостей, що стосуються програм, написаних на мовах програмування Java та C#. Було виявлено, що такі загрози, як ін'єкція SQL-запитів, вразливості XSS (міжсайтовий скриптінг), вразливості переповнення буфера та інші, можуть становити серйозну загрозу для безпеки програмного забезпечення. Для захисту програм від цих загроз було розглянуто основні механізми кіберзахисту, доступні у мовах програмування Java та C#. Серед них були виокремлені виключення, контроль доступу, шифрування даних та перевірка вводу. Ці механізми можуть бути використані для запобігання різним видам атак та злому програмного забезпечення. Порівняно можливості кіберзахисту у Java та C# та визначено переваги та недоліки кожної мови з точки зору безпеки програмного забезпечення. Зроблено висновки про важливість кіберзахисту на мовах програмування Java та C# та надано рекомендації для розробників програмного забезпечення стосовно свідомого підходу до кіберзахисту та використання відповідних методів та технік для забезпечення безпеки своїх програм. Аналітично визначено переваги захисту від DDOS-атак шляхом використання обмеження кількості запитів за певний проміжок часу, а також реалізації авторизації та ролей користувачів. Запропоновано використання захисту від DDOS-атак шляхом обмеження кількості запитів, авторизацію користувачів та доступ по ролям, що може бути корисним для розробників програмного забезпечення, які працюють з мовами програмування Java та C#. ; Analyze and compare the cyber security capabilities of Java and C# and identify the advantages and disadvantages of each language from a software ... |
| Druh dokumentu: |
article in journal/newspaper |
| Jazyk: |
Ukrainian |
| Relation: |
https://er.knutd.edu.ua/handle/123456789/24477 |
| Dostupnosť: |
https://er.knutd.edu.ua/handle/123456789/24477 |
| Prístupové číslo: |
edsbas.C6A0976C |
| Databáza: |
BASE |